First lady marks women’s day anchoring news on radio

Mrs. Barbie Ithungo Kyagulanyi, the wife to the National Unity Platform party president Bobi Wine has this morning marked the international women’s day celebrations anchoring news at Buganda Kingdom owned Radio dubbed Central Broadcasting Services (CBS).

Barbie, a prominent pillar in charity and feminism was invited to be the anchor of the day as the country marks the international women’s day celebrations.

On her return from the radio, she in a brief statement applauded the management of CBS for considering her for the grande moment of anchoring news before an heterogeneous audience.

“To mark International Women’s day today, I was hosted at Cbs Fm 88.8 Emanduso to read the 9am bulletins. Among the headlines featured was a call by different women leaders to women and girls to embrace technology and use it to improve their skills. Digital technology can be a powerful tool for promoting gender equality and empowering women and girls to achieve their full potential. So, use these platforms to the benefit of all women and humanity in general,” she wrote on Facebook.
